What to Do After an Accident in Coral Springs (33067)

Acting quickly and carefully after an accident protects both your health and your legal position.

1. Call 911. Get law enforcement to the scene and make sure a crash report is filed. That official document is essential evidence in any personal injury claim.

2. See a doctor the same day. Even if you feel only mild discomfort, get examined by a physician immediately. Injuries like TBIs and internal trauma often present with a delay.

3. Photograph everything at the scene. Capture all vehicles, road markings, traffic signals, debris, and your injuries. Document the surrounding environment before anything is disturbed.

4. Collect witness contact information. Eyewitnesses on Wiles Road or Coral Ridge Drive can provide independent accounts that support your version of events.

5. Do not give recorded statements to the other driver’s insurer. Insurance adjusters contact accident victims quickly. Do not provide any statement until you have consulted with an attorney.

Florida Law — What 33067 Residents Need to Know

  • Statute of limitations: Under Florida’s 2023 tort reform law (HB 837), you have two years from the accident date to file a negligence claim. Missing that deadline permanently bars your ability to recover in court.
  • PIP insurance: Florida requires all drivers to carry at least $10,000 in Personal Injury Protection. You must begin medical treatment within 14 days of your accident to preserve access to those benefits.
  • Modified comparative negligence: Florida bars any recovery if you are found 51% or more at fault. Below that threshold, your compensation is reduced proportionally based on your share of responsibility.
  • Serious injury threshold: To pursue pain and suffering damages beyond PIP, you must establish a serious injury — meaning significant or permanent impairment, significant scarring or disfigurement, or death.

What if my accident happened in a parking lot in the 33067 area? Parking lot accidents can involve driver negligence, property owner liability, or both. An attorney can investigate the facts and identify all responsible parties and available insurance.

What if the other driver was uninsured? Florida does not require drivers to carry bodily injury liability coverage, which means uninsured drivers are a real risk. Your own uninsured motorist policy may cover your damages. Call (305) 842-2100 to review your coverage options.
